Across the available record, Wexford Irish Pub has four inspections on file, the first dated 2024. The most recent visit was on Jan 13, 2026. Low risk means the most recent visit produced few or no significant findings.

Performance has remained roughly level over recent inspections, averaging near two violations each time.

Looking across the full record, “proper cold holding temperatures” is the recurring theme, flagged two times.

The city-wide average sits at 90, which Wexford Irish Pub's 86 doesn't quite reach. Overall, the inspection record reads well.

Inspection History
Jan 13, 2026
Routine
1 critical violation. 1 corrected on site.
View 1 violation
6-1A - proper cold holding temperatures (corrected on site)
Inspector notes: Observed TCS food items (tomatoes and cheese) holding above 41F in prep top units. See temperature log to see exact temperature and ambient. CA: PIC immediately placed items on ice to rapidly cool. Food items still within SAFE zone. Time/temperature control for safety food shall be maintained at 41°F (5°C) or below.
511-6-1.04(6)(f)

Jun 6, 2025
Routine
1 critical violation. 1 major violation. 1 minor violation. 2 corrected on site.
View 3 violations
4-1A - food separated and protected (corrected on site)
Inspector notes: Observed raw salmon, burgers, and chicken stored above sliced RTE meats and cooked mashed potatoes. (COS- PIC removed raw salmon, burgers and chicken from the RTE cooler.) RCA: Ensure to arrange raw animal foods below RTE food items and according to minimum cook temperature.
511-6-1.04(4)(c)
8-2B - toxic substances properly identified, stored, used (corrected on site)
Inspector notes: Observed working containers of sanitizer stored at the waiter station without a label with a common name. (COS- PIC labeled working containers of chemicals.) RCA: Ensure all working containers of chemicals are labeled with a common name at all times.
511-6-1.07(6)(b)
14A - in-use utensils: properly stored
Inspector notes: Observed 2 ice scoops stored in the ice bin with handles touching the ice. (COS- PIC replaced scoops in bins with the handle facing up.) RCA: Ensure all scoops stored in non TCS food items have the handle facing away from food items at all times.
511-6-1.04(4)(k)

Nov 18, 2024
Routine
2 critical violations. 2 corrected on site.
View 2 violations
5-1A - proper cooking time and temperatures (corrected on site)
Inspector notes: Observed temperature of a just cooked burger to be at 135F. Burgers do not have the option to be served undercooked on the menu and do not have a consumer advisory for raw or undercooked foods on the menu. CA: raw animal foods such as eggs, fish, meat, poultry, and foods containing these raw animal foods, shall be cooked to heat all parts of the food to a temperature and for a time that complies with one of the following methods based on the food that is being cooked: 155°F (68°C) for 15 seconds or the temperature specified in the following chart that corresponds to the holding time for ratites, mechanically tenderized, and injected meats; the following if they are comminuted: fish, meat, game animals raised for food, and commercially game animals or under a voluntary inspection program...
511-6-1.04(5)(a)
6-1A - proper cold holding temperatures (corrected on site)
Inspector notes: Observed several TCS foods cold-holding above 41F in prep-top units (sliced tomatoes, feta cheese, salmon, and crab cake ) (see temperature log). CA: PIC discarded all TCS foods held over 4 hours in the prep top units. TCS foods that were prepped within the hour were placed on an ice bath or in the walk-in cooler to cool down.
511-6-1.04(6)(f)
